guess it depends on whatever deal Netflix has with WB Japan, it could be just a normal simulcast (Dungeon Meshi, Watakekkon, Hikaru, Ranma, Four Knights of The Apocalypse, Orb), have JP be a week ahead (Blue Box, Sakamoto Days), delay the show until the dub is ready (Kaoru Hana), or just dump it (maybe in batches) (Beastars, Stone Ocean, Melody, Moonrise, Leviathan, perhaps Dorohedoro S2 if that comes out this year).
